2022 RBC Heritage sold out, strong field headed to Harbour Town

Perhaps the best field in any recent RBC Heritage not held in the bizarro year of 2020 will be en route to Hilton Head Island soon, and if you’re planning on seeing the 54th annual Heritage in person at Harbour Town Golf Links, you better have tickets already.


The Heritage Classic Foundation announced Saturday that the tournament is officially sold out despite a return to “full capacity” this year, though tournament director Steve Wilmot noted on LowcoGolf.com’s “Quick 9” that full capacity in 2022 does not mean what it did in 2019.


“One of the things people have to understand, on Saturday in 2019, if you were there, it wasn't necessarily a good thing,” Wilmot said. “We couldn't have gotten another body out there. So from what we've gone through the last couple years, we're looking at an enhanced experience for our spectators. Our full build out will happen, but we're limiting ticket sales a little bit to the square full capacity to be kind of 80% of where we were in 2019.”


If you do have tickets, be advised that all ticketing for the 2022 RBC Heritage is mobile. There are 10 ticket scanning areas around Harbour Town Golf Links and at Honey Horn’s general spectator parking. Ticket holders are urged to save tickets to their phone’s mobile wallet for easy access. Once a ticket has been scanned, the spectator will be given a paper ticket to wear for the day.


If you didn’t score tickets, don’t despair. You can still catch the parade from the Harbour Town Yacht Basin to the iconic 18th green just before noon Tuesday and take in the Opening Ceremony, in which defending champion Stewart Cink, a three-time Heritage winner, will hit the ceremonial opening tee shot into Calibogue Sound.


You’lll also be able to catch the action on PGA Tour Live and Golf Channel throughout the tournament and on CBS on Saturday and Sunday. The full broadcast schedule is below.
